Try To See It My Way

Out Of Stock

Add Item to Want List
LP (Item 505531) Sonday, 1972 — Condition: Used

Produced by Dionne Warwick with Richard Rome and Don Sebesky arrangements – on titles that include a cover of Donny Hathaway's "Je Vous Aime Oui Je Fais" – plus "Love Is A Good Foundation", "I Just Can't Help Believin", "Love Of My Man", "Rescue Me", "The Weight Song", and "Brighten Hill".
